Description

Transfusion system
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of infusion apparatuses, in particular to an infusion apparatus.
Background
Along with the continuous development of society and the continuous progress of medical industry, intravenous infusion has become the most common treatment means in daily treatment, and when intravenous infusion, medicine needs to be input into the human body through the infusion set, so the infusion set becomes the most important use tool of intravenous infusion.
The utility model with the bulletin number of CN208809211U discloses a sectional type blood transfusion and infusion device, wherein the sectional type blood transfusion and infusion device provided by the utility model is characterized in that two pairs of luer connectors divide the blood transfusion and infusion device into three parts: the drip section comprises a bottle stopper puncture device, a drip cup drip tube, a drip cup and a drip cup output tube, when the sectional blood transfusion and infusion device is used for blood transfusion and plasma is blocked in the drip cup, the problem of plasma blocking can be solved by only disassembling the first luer connector and replacing the drip section, the replacement is time-saving, and the operation is simple; in addition, after the plasma or the injection is heated, the generated gas is accumulated in the gas collecting kettle, so that the gas cannot be input into a human body along with the plasma or the injection, and secondary injury to a patient is avoided.
The infusion set has the following defects when in use: when the infusion device is used, the infusion device is inserted into the medicine bottle, because the insertion depth of the puncture device is longer, when the medicine bottle is inverted for infusion, the medicine liquid remained at the bottle mouth cannot pass through the puncture device, at the moment, the medicine bottle needs to be pulled out a little slowly outwards with great trouble, the infusion device is inconvenient to use, automatic closing is not convenient when the medicine water is dripped, and air easily enters the input tube, so that the infusion device is provided for solving the problems.
Disclosure of Invention
The utility model provides an infusion apparatus, which solves the defects that in the prior art, medicine liquid remained at a bottle opening cannot pass through a puncture outfit, a little is required to be pulled out slowly outwards, the use is very troublesome, automatic closing is inconvenient when medicine water is dripped, and air is easy to enter an input pipe.
The utility model provides the following technical scheme:
an infusion set comprising:
the infusion tube is inserted into the medicine bottle through the contact pin, the other end of the infusion tube is inserted with a puncture needle for puncturing a blood vessel, a handle is fixedly sleeved on the outer wall of the contact pin, and a baffle ring is fixedly connected to the top of the handle;
the regulator is arranged on the infusion tube and used for regulating the flow speed of the liquid medicine;
the dropper is arranged on the infusion tube, and a filter plate for defoaming liquid medicine is arranged in the dropper;
and the limiting mechanism is arranged on the infusion tube and used for limiting the length of the contact pin inserted into the medicine bottle.
In one possible design, the limiting mechanism comprises a connecting ring sleeved on the outer wall of the contact pin, one side of the connecting ring is fixedly connected with a connecting strip, the outer wall of the connecting strip is sleeved with a connecting sheet, and one side of the connecting sheet is fixedly connected with a clamping ring for connecting the contact pin with the medicine bottle.
In one possible design, the top of connection piece runs through fixedly connected with spacing ring, a plurality of openings have been seted up at the top of spacing ring, a plurality of frangible grooves have been seted up at the top of spacing ring, the fixed cover of outer wall of connecting strip is equipped with a plurality of lugs that grow in proper order and frangible groove are corresponding.
In one possible design, the top of burette runs through fixedly connected with first connecting pipe, first connecting pipe communicates with each other with the contact pin and is connected, the bottom of burette runs through fixedly connected with second connecting pipe, second connecting pipe and the one end fixed connection of transfer line, in the one end of second connecting pipe extends to the burette, a plurality of through-holes that are located the burette have been seted up to the outer wall of second connecting pipe.
In one possible design, the second connecting pipe is internally provided with a floating rod in a sliding manner, the inner wall of the second connecting pipe is provided with a floating ball in a sliding manner, the floating ball is fixedly connected to the bottom of the floating rod, the filter plate is fixedly connected to the top of the floating rod, and the inner wall of the second connecting pipe is fixedly connected with a sealing ring matched with the floating ball.
In one possible design, the depth of the plurality of frangible grooves is sequentially shallower from inside to outside.
It is to be understood that both the foregoing general description and the following detailed description are exemplary and explanatory only and are not restrictive of the utility model as claimed.
According to the utility model, the handle is pulled to drive the contact pin to move downwards, the connecting strip is driven to move downwards until the small lug drives the limiting ring to break, the large lug is abutted against the connecting sheet, the contact pin can be positioned, the liquid medicine in the medicine bottle can completely flow out at the moment, meanwhile, the floating ball descends to seal the sealing ring, and the air in the infusion tube can be prevented from entering, so that the infusion tube is convenient to use.
According to the utility model, when the liquid medicine in the dropper is high, the floating rod and the floating ball can be driven to float upwards in the second connecting pipe, the filter plate can be driven to move upwards, the filter plate can be driven to float upwards and downwards when the liquid medicine drops on the filter plate, the liquid medicine in the dropper can be defoamed while floating, meanwhile, the dropping distance of the liquid medicine can be reduced, the generation of bubbles can be reduced, the floating ball descends to seal the sealing ring, and the air in the infusion tube can be prevented from entering, so that the infusion tube is convenient to use;
according to the utility model, the length of the contact pin inserted into the medicine bottle can be limited by the cooperation of the connecting strip and the connecting sheet, so that the medicine liquid in the medicine bottle can flow out completely, the filter plate can be driven to float up and down to foam the medicine liquid by the floating ball and the sealing ring, the dropper can be sealed when the medicine drops, and air is prevented from entering the infusion tube.

Example 2
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, an infusion set includes:
the infusion tube 1, one end of the infusion tube 1 is fixedly connected with a contact pin 3, a medicine bottle 5 is arranged above the infusion tube 1, the infusion tube 1 is inserted into the medicine bottle 5 through the contact pin 3, the other end of the infusion tube 1 is inserted with a puncture needle 7 for puncturing a blood vessel, a handle 4 is fixedly sleeved on the outer wall of the contact pin 3, and the top of the handle 4 is fixedly connected with a baffle ring 11;
the regulator 6 is arranged on the infusion tube 1 and is used for regulating the flow speed of the liquid medicine;
the dropper 2, the dropper 2 is arranged on the infusion tube 1, and a filter plate 10 for defoaming liquid medicine is arranged in the dropper 2;
the limiting mechanism is arranged on the infusion tube 1 and used for limiting the length of the contact pin 3 inserted into the medicine bottle 5, the length of the contact pin 3 inserted into the medicine bottle 5 can be limited through the limiting mechanism in the technical scheme, the liquid medicine remaining on the bottle opening can flow out conveniently, the contact pin 3 and the medicine bottle 5 can be prevented from being separated in the using process, and the liquid medicine in the dropper 2 can be defoamed through the upper and lower floating of the filter plate 10, so that the use is more convenient.
Referring to fig. 3, the limiting mechanism comprises a connecting ring 14 sleeved on the outer wall of the contact pin 3, one side of the connecting ring 14 is fixedly connected with a connecting strip 15, a connecting sheet 13 is sleeved on the outer wall of the connecting strip 15, one side of the connecting sheet 13 is fixedly connected with a clamping ring 12 for connecting the contact pin 3 with the medicine bottle 5, the clamping ring 12 and the connecting ring 14 can be connected together through the connecting strip 15 in the technical scheme, and the clamping ring 12 can be clamped on the bottle mouth of the medicine bottle 5, so that the contact pin 3 and the medicine bottle 5 can be connected together.
Referring to fig. 3 and 4, the top of the connecting piece 13 is fixedly connected with a limiting ring 17 in a penetrating manner, a plurality of openings 18 are formed in the top of the limiting ring 17, a plurality of frangible grooves 19 are formed in the top of the limiting ring 17, a plurality of lugs 16 which are sequentially enlarged and correspond to the frangible grooves 19 are fixedly sleeved on the outer wall of the connecting strip 15, the lugs 16 can be driven to move by pulling the connecting strip 15 in the technical scheme, and when the smaller lugs 16 are abutted against the frangible grooves 19, the limiting ring 17 can be driven to break by continuing pulling, so that the length of the connecting strip 15 is conveniently positioned, and the connecting strip is suitable for medicine bottles 5 with different sizes.
Referring to fig. 2, the top of the dropper 2 is fixedly connected with a first connecting pipe 8, the first connecting pipe 8 is connected with the contact pin 3 in a communicating way, the bottom of the dropper 2 is fixedly connected with a second connecting pipe 9 in a penetrating way, the second connecting pipe 9 is fixedly connected with one end of the infusion tube 1, one end of the second connecting pipe 9 extends into the dropper 2, a plurality of through holes positioned in the dropper 2 are formed in the outer wall of the second connecting pipe 9, the medicine liquid can flow into the infusion tube 1 conveniently through the through holes in the second connecting pipe 9 in the technical scheme, the filter plate 10 can be limited, and the drop height of the medicine liquid can be reduced conveniently.
Referring to fig. 2, 5 and 6, a floating rod 20 is slidably arranged in the second connecting pipe 9, a floating ball 21 is slidably arranged on the inner wall of the second connecting pipe 9, the floating ball 21 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the floating rod 20, the filter plate 10 is fixedly connected to the top of the floating rod 20, a sealing ring 22 matched with the floating ball 21 is fixedly connected to the inner wall of the second connecting pipe 9, and after the liquid medicine pinched by the dropper 2 flows out, the floating ball 21 abuts against the sealing ring 22 to seal the second connecting pipe 9 under the action of gravity, so that transfusion can be automatically closed conveniently.
Referring to fig. 4, the depth of the plurality of frangible grooves 19 is sequentially reduced from inside to outside, and in the above technical scheme, the spacing ring 17 can be conveniently and sequentially broken from inside to outside by setting the frangible grooves 19, and the length of the connecting strip 15 from the connecting piece 13 can be conveniently adjusted from short to long.
The working principle and the using flow of the technical scheme are as follows: when the infusion bottle is used, the contact pin 3 is inserted into the medicine bottle 5, the clamping ring 12 is clamped at the bottle mouth of the medicine bottle 5 until the baffle ring 11 is abutted against the medicine bottle 5, the regulator 6 is opened until the medicine liquid in the medicine bottle 5 flows out through the needle insertion 7, the regulator 6 is closed, the needle insertion 7 is inserted into a vein and fixed, the regulator 6 is opened at the moment, the medicine liquid in the medicine bottle 5 can drop into the dropper 2, when the medicine liquid in the dropper 2 is high, the floating rod 20 and the floating ball 21 can be driven to float upwards in the second connecting pipe 9, the filter plate 10 can be driven to move upwards, the medicine liquid can be driven to float upwards and downwards when the medicine liquid drops on the filter plate 10, foam can be carried out on the medicine liquid 2 while floating, the bubble generation can be reduced when the drop distance of the medicine liquid can be reduced, when the medicine liquid in the medicine bottle 5 is lower than the contact pin 3, the handle 4 can be driven to move downwards, the connecting bar 15 is driven to move downwards until the small bump 16 drives the limiting ring 17 to break, the large bump 16 is abutted against the connecting piece 13, the medicine liquid 3 can be positioned, the medicine bottle 3 can be driven to flow out completely, the sealing ring 21 can be sealed, and the air can be prevented from entering the infusion bottle 1 at the same time, and the sealing ring can be sealed.
